Transaction 3a62bf29377825441fd5209e2a772c587e5c23f870891365c17cb8571c165174

1 Input
2 Outputs
  • 3a62bf29377825441fd5209e2a772c587e5c23f870891365c17cb8571c165174:0
  • value  41901
    address  36v3kPXpFPC5bhWdo8YntQvfoeowdymQwS
  • 3a62bf29377825441fd5209e2a772c587e5c23f870891365c17cb8571c165174:1
  • value  782456
    address  3B5ffSik4hNevDjktdNENk6KVp5h2a3H6L